Mary Johanna (Agurkis) Mallio of Burlington, formerly a long time resident of Needham died on Sunday, February 27, 2011 at Sunrise of Burlington from Alzheimer’s disease. She was 89 years old. Mary was born in Lawrence, MA, spent her early life in Boston and lived 49 years in Needham Heights, when she took up residence at Sunrise Senior Living in Burlington. She was as a long-time employee of the William Carter Company. The wife of the late Bartholomew R. (“Pete”) Mallio, she as the mother of Richard Mallio and his wife Osee of Arlington and Palm Bay FL, William Mallio and his wife Nancy of Winchester, and her daughter-in-law, Judy Mallio of Franklin. She was predeceased by two sons, Charles and Stephen. Mary was greatly loved by her grandchildren, Douglass and his wife Heather of Pittsfield, Charlotte and her fiancé Steven Gallant of Mansfield, Lisa Forester of Huntsville, AL, Bartholomew and his wife Janine Manheim of Kings Park, NY, Andrew and his wife Kristi of Westford, Matthew and his wife Sara of Concord, Charles and his wife Kimberly of Franklin, Bonnie Mitchell and her husband Scott of North Attleboro and six great grandchildren. Funeral from the Eaton Funeral Home 1351 Highland Ave Needham on Friday, March 4 at 10 AM followed by a Mass of Christian Burial in St. Joseph Church at 11:30 AM. Relatives and friends are kindly invited to attend. Visiting hours Friday from 10 AM to11:15 prior to Mass. Interment at the Lithuanian Cooperative Cemetery in Nashua, NH
